This course is aimed at intermediate potters and ACS members who know how to throw on the pottery wheel but are keen to learn new techniques and improve their practice. Week 1: Getting to know you Participants will take their most comfortable weight on the throwing wheel and show us what you can do! We will improve your basic throwing techniques in any way we can and provide and advice on how to handle larger amounts of clay than you're used to. We will also explore which techniques you would Week 2: Introduction to Turning This week you will refine your thrown forms from the previous week. We will practice trimming excess clay from the bottoms of pots to create attractive bases and achieve desired thickness and proportions. We will also cover trimming techniques for decorations and creating galleries for lids. Week 3-4: Advanced Techniques: Measurement, Lids, and Handles During these two weeks, participants will advance their skills by learning to measure clay accurately for consistent vessel sizes. You will also explore techniques for creating and fitting lids onto pots, as well as attaching handles securely. Week 5-8: Self-Directed Projects with Support In these four weeks, participants will have the opportunity to work on self-directed projects while receiving guidance and support from the instructor. Students will have the freedom to experiment with the throwing process and apply the techniques they've learned. The instructor will be available for assistance and problem solving on whatever project you would most like to learn. Your favourite pieces from this course will be fired and glazed for you to take home and enjoy. You will be notified by email when your work is ready to collect.
